Definitions and Meaning of restricted in English

restricted adjective

  1. the lowest level of official classification for documents
  2. restricted in meaning; (as e.g. `man' in `a tall man')
  3. subject to restriction or subjected to restriction

    Example

    • "of restricted importance"
